Thiago Talk
The arrival of Alexis Mac Allister and Dominik Szoboszlai has put into question Thiago‘s future. David Lynch writes for This Is Anfield that “though This Is Anfield understands that the Reds have yet to receive any offers this summer, they are aware of suggestions that several clubs are keeping tabs on Thiago.” With only a year remaining on his contract – one that makes him the third highest-paid player at the club – and no guarantee of a starting spot, would this summer be the right time to sell up?

Premier League Movers and Remainers
Plenty of Premier League talk today, with teams preparing to return for pre-season this week. Crystal Palace finally confirmed Roy Hodgson will continue as manager next season – and he says they’re targeting a top-half finish. Brighton signed Netherlands under-21s goalkeeper Bart Verbruggen from Anderlecht for £16.3 million. Another potential club for Caoimhin Kelleher ruled out. RB Leipzig’s sporting director has confirmed that Josko Gvardiol has told them he wants to join Man City, with an £86m fee mooted – which would be a world record for a defender.
